description Gastric cancer is a malignant tumor that originates from the cells of the inner layer of the organ. It is characterized by a long asymptomatic period. The incidence of gastric cancer increases after the age of 50, especially in the male population. The aim of the study was to analyze selected aspects of nursing care provided to a patient after total gastrectomy in the course of gastric cancer. Materials and methods. The study used the case study method and an individual case study of a patient diagnosed with gastric cancer. Results and conclusions. The patient has problems in the biopsychosocial sphere. The role of a nurse in caring for a sick person is comprehensive care, education and preparation for self-care, and above all mental support. Constant monitoring of the patient's health greatly helps to prevent possible complications.
